That is not a 220 plug. It is a recreational plug used on campers. They make an adapter for that. You can get them a walmart less that 10.00.

Yes it is. That is what 1 chain with two binders will do. But what really works good is a step deck with container locks. No chains needed.
Used to do it all the time. 1 chain equals two chains in that configuration. Makes it easier.
2 chains 4 binders at corners =26400 + 3 straps 15000 = 41400. would that not be correct?
No 1 chain in the front 1 in the back tie the corners down and 2 or 3 straps across container.
